Design and Build Quality

Both the Magentak U-Shaped Ultrasonic Toothbrush and the SVKCO Ultrasonic Toothbrush feature a unique U-shaped design aimed at providing comprehensive cleaning of teeth. The Magentak toothbrush uses silicone for its construction, which includes a total of 1968 bristles that promote detailed cleaning of teeth. Meanwhile, the SVKCO toothbrush is made from food-grade environmentally friendly silicone and ABS, emphasizing its safety and durability. While both designs are crafted to fit the shape of your teeth, the Magentak toothbrush is particularly notable for its high-frequency sonic vibrations that can reach up to 35,000 vibrations per minute, compared to SVKCO's unspecified frequency. This might suggest a potentially more effective cleaning experience with the Magentak model.

Cleaning Performance

The cleaning performance of both toothbrushes is enhanced by their sonic vibration technology. The Magentak toothbrush offers three high-performance modes—standard, fast, and super-speed—allowing users to customize their brushing experience. In contrast, the SVKCO toothbrush features four modes: powerful, medium, gum massage, and whitening. This range of options in the SVKCO toothbrush may appeal to users looking for a more tailored dental care routine. However, both products claim to significantly improve gum health compared to manual brushing, with the SVKCO toothbrush suggesting a 100% improvement in gum health over traditional methods.

Battery Life and Charging

The Magentak toothbrush comes equipped with a 500mAh rechargeable battery that allows for 1-2 weeks of use after a four-hour charge. This extended battery life is a strong point for those who prefer less frequent charging. On the other hand, the SVKCO toothbrush utilizes a wireless charging base that offers a week's worth of use with just three hours of charging. While the SVKCO toothbrush provides a quick charging solution, the Magentak toothbrush’s longer usage time may make it more convenient for travel and everyday use, allowing for uninterrupted dental care.

Waterproofing and Durability

Waterproofing is an essential feature for any electric toothbrush, and both models are designed with this in mind. The Magentak toothbrush boasts an IPX7 waterproof rating, which means it can withstand immersion in water without damage. This feature ensures easy cleaning and adds to the product's longevity. Similarly, the SVKCO toothbrush's construction also emphasizes super water resistance, allowing it to be washed and reused without concern. Both products are built to withstand the rigors of daily use, but the Magentak's explicit IPX7 rating may provide added peace of mind for users.
